The Beautiful Mondrian Los Angeles: A Redesign Done Right

The Mondrian Los Angeles was redesigned at the end of last year by Benjamin Noriega-Ortiz, one of the most stylish and influential interior designers today. Noriega-Ortiz has designed projects for celebrities like Lenny Kravitz and P-Diddy, both who surely appreciated his perspective on modern design - clean lines and simple patterns. The newly designed Mondrian hotel lobby, lounge, and guest rooms all speak to his philosophy; he marries modern and classical pieces to create an experience no one will soon forget.

Part of the Morgans Hotel Group, the Mondrian was first designed by none other than Philippe Starck. In fact, some of Starck's original work has been left in tact; Noriega-Ortiz had such high regard for Starck that he stated, "“I didn’t want to eradicate Philippe Starck’s original vision, I wanted to build on it; I wanted to enhance it.”

Though I appreciate the wild and whimsical nature of hotels like the SLS, the Mondrian's holds the key to my modern heart.
